dc.descriptionThe scalar and vector self-energies obtained through QCD sum rules are introduced in Quantum Hadrodynamics (QHD) equations. The results indicate that the ratios of coupling constants to respective meson mass have a very small dependence on density. Then, an extended Brown-Rho scaling law is conjectured.
